Switching from PlayerAuctions — What to Check First
- Confirm region coverage — your Valorant region (EU, NA, AP, BR, LA, KR) must be supported. Half the savings disappear if you have to compromise on region.
- Verify buyer protection window — 14 days is the industry baseline. Anything shorter is a downgrade from PA.
- Read the dispute process — How is "account doesn't match listing" handled? Is there a 1-hour SLA on recovery attempts? PA's process is well-documented; alternatives vary.
- Check the platform's policy on account recovery — what happens if the seller attempts to recover the account 5 days post-sale? Verified-only platforms ban the seller and refund you. Open marketplaces vary.
- Compare prices on identical SKUs — find an account with the exact same rank/region/skin profile on PA and the alternative. The price spread is the savings.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is PlayerAuctions still the safest option in 2026?
Within its Verified-Sellers tier, yes. The general non-verified tier carries the standard risks of open marketplaces. Specialist verified-only platforms (BuyAccount, AccountKings) are equally safe within their narrower scope and often faster.
Why are alternatives cheaper than PlayerAuctions?
Lower seller commissions, smaller overhead, specialist focus (fewer games supported means lower platform complexity). PA's price reflects its breadth (50+ games) and brand-recognition premium.
Can I trust new marketplaces?
Trust newer specialist marketplaces only when they (a) use platform-mediated escrow, (b) publish buyer protection terms clearly, and (c) have a real dispute-resolution channel. The size of Trustpilot's review base correlates with longevity, not always with safety on individual transactions.
